Window Remodeling in Framingham, MA
Window remodeling services encompass a range of projects aimed at upgrading, replacing, or enhancing existing windows within residential properties. These projects often include installing new energy-efficient windows, updating window frames for improved aesthetics, or resizing existing openings to better suit the home's design. Homeowners typically seek window remodeling to improve curb appeal, increase energy savings, or address issues like drafts, broken glass, or outdated styles. Understanding the different types of window materials, styles, and the potential impact on home comfort can help property owners make informed decisions before requesting services.
Before initiating a window remodeling project, property owners usually want to consider factors such as the scope of work, compatibility with the home's architecture, and the benefits of various window options. It’s also common to evaluate the impact on natural light, ventilation, and overall energy performance. Clarifying these details can ensure that the remodeling aligns with the property’s needs and aesthetic preferences, leading to a more satisfying outcome. Contacting a professional can provide guidance on suitable materials, design choices, and the best solutions for specific property conditions.

Common Window Remodeling Jobs
Window Replacement - upgrading outdated or damaged windows to improve energy efficiency and curb appeal.
Casement Window Remodeling - updating crank-out windows for better ventilation and modern style.
Bay and Bow Window Renovation - enhancing living spaces with expanded views and added natural light.
Custom Window Installation - creating tailored solutions for unique window shapes and architectural styles.
Energy-Efficient Window Upgrades - replacing old windows with models that reduce heating and cooling costs.
Historic Window Restoration - preserving character while improving functionality in older homes.
Window Remodeling Questions
What types of window remodeling services are available? Services include replacing outdated windows, upgrading to energy-efficient models, and customizing window designs for aesthetic or functional improvements.
Can window remodeling improve energy efficiency? Yes, upgrading to modern, insulated windows can help reduce energy loss and improve overall energy performance of a property.
What should homeowners consider before remodeling windows? Consider the style of the property, the durability of materials, and how the new windows will complement existing architecture.
Are there different window styles to choose from during remodeling? Yes, options include casement, double-hung, sliding, and picture windows, among others, to suit various preferences and needs.
